We are seeking an experienced Residential Senior Accountant to support our U.S.-based real estate and property management accounting team. This offshore role will manage a portfolio of multifamily properties and assist with high-level staff accountant responsibilities to ensure accurate timely and audit-ready financial reporting. Experience with AppFolio is required.
Key Responsibilities:
Prepare monthly quarterly and annual financial statements for assigned residential properties
Perform full month-end and year-end close including journal entries accruals and variance analysis
Reconcile bank accounts property allocations balance sheet accounts and general ledger activity
Review and oversee accounts payable and accounts receivable activity
Maintain tenant ledgers and support rent rolls collections and lease administration
Assist with budgeting forecasting and budget-to-actual analysis
Support property onboarding and new entity setup in Appfolio
Assist with investor reporting owner distributions and supporting schedules
Provide documentation for audits tax preparation and internal reviews
Identify process improvements and support cross-functional accounting initiatives
